DESCRIPTION:
The Property Accountant is responsible for the property accounting functions within the framework of Talos Energy’s policies and procedures and in compliance of applicable regulations.
D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:
This position will be responsible for numerous property accounting activities at Talos Energy including but not limited to:
- Tracking and recording fuel transfers and usage on offshore vessels
- Maintaining and recording the Asset Retirement Obligations schedule for liabilities assumed from defaulted working interest partners or successors in interest
- Calculating and recording monthly depletion, depreciation and amortization (“DD&A”) of oil and gas properties
- Performing quarterly Ceiling Tests to assess impairment
- Preparing and maintaining multiple account reconciliations
- Executing and revising SOX controls as needed
